Recover information in such cases
- Failed / failed RAID controller.
- Failed update firmware controller raid array.
- Damage to the motherboard server.
- Removing / Losing Server Configuration.
- Failure during the migration procedure of the array.
- Failed to resize partitions.
- Crash when changing volumes LVM.
- Disable one or more disks.
- After fires and floods.
- Degradation of carrier surfaces, BAD sector.
- Hardware damage to the network storage NAS, Q-NAP, JBOD.
- Wrong connected HDD.
- Power failure.
